A set of patterns for Tailwind CSS version 4, a utility-based system for styling websites. It covers CSS-based configuration, container queries, and reusable design tokens such as colors, spacing, and fonts.

In plain words
What is it for?
Use it when configuring Tailwind v4 themes, defining CSS variables, organizing design tokens, using native CSS nesting, or building responsive components with container queries.
Why use it?
It helps developers follow Tailwind v4’s current configuration model instead of relying on older version 3 practices. It also gives structure to shared visual values across a project.

Tailwind CSS Patterns (v4 - 2025)

Modern utility-first CSS with CSS-native configuration.


1. Tailwind v4 Architecture

What Changed from v3

v3 (Legacy) v4 (Current)
tailwind.config.js CSS-based @theme directive
PostCSS plugin Oxide engine (10x faster)
JIT mode Native, always-on
Plugin system CSS-native features
@apply directive Still works, discouraged

v4 Core Concepts

Concept Description
CSS-first Configuration in CSS, not JavaScript
Oxide Engine Rust-based compiler, much faster
Native Nesting CSS nesting without PostCSS
CSS Variables All tokens exposed as --* vars

2. CSS-Based Configuration

Theme Definition

@theme {
  /* Colors - use semantic names */
  --color-primary: oklch(0.7 0.15 250);
  --color-surface: oklch(0.98 0 0);
  --color-surface-dark: oklch(0.15 0 0);
  
  /* Spacing scale */
  --spacing-xs: 0.25rem;
  --spacing-sm: 0.5rem;
  --spacing-md: 1rem;
  --spacing-lg: 2rem;
  
  /* Typography */
  --font-sans: 'Inter', system-ui, sans-serif;
  --font-mono: 'JetBrains Mono', monospace;
}

When to Extend vs Override

Action Use When
Extend Adding new values alongside defaults
Override Replacing default scale entirely
Semantic tokens Project-specific naming (primary, surface)

3. Container Queries (v4 Native)

Breakpoint vs Container

Type Responds To
Breakpoint (md:) Viewport width
Container (@container) Parent element width

Container Query Usage

Pattern Classes
Define container @container on parent
Container breakpoint @sm:, @md:, @lg: on children
Named containers @container/card for specificity

When to Use

Scenario Use
Page-level layouts Viewport breakpoints
Component-level responsive Container queries
Reusable components Container queries (context-independent)
